Work from Office
Full Time
Applications are invited from highly motivated engineers who are passionate about learning new technologies and utilize that skill to build next generation of Oracle CPQ Applications. Oracle CPQ is an interesting and challenging application domain consisting of web UI, batch processing, workflow, analytics and integration with other product domains. Qualifications: Bachelors or Masters Degree(B.E. / B.Tech. / M.C.A / M.Tech. / M.S.) from reputed universities. Experience 4+ years hands-on experience with web application development using Java and open-source technologies. These should include Core Java, JAXB, SOAP, XML ,JSON, XML/XSLT ,Junit, JMock/Mockito, swagger/open API Strong Object-Oriented design skills with ability to abstract out design patterns Strong knowledge of Spring and Dependency Injection (IOC) Experience in design & development of REST APIs using java Understanding of source code management tools such as Git Knowledge of UI technologies - Ajax, Knockout, jQuery, FreeMarker,Javascript, CSS Knowledge of one or more of the RDBMS is highly desirable: DB2, Oracle, MS SQL Server Experience with Eclipse/JDeveloper or similar development environments Knowledge of security/access control and internationalization. Strong verbal and written communication skills in English language . Strong track record in delivering complex, high quality software to production users in a timely fashion Ability to work as part of an interactive, collaborative team as well as independently. Fast learner, self-motivated, result-oriented and Can-do attitude. Strong analytical and problem solving skills. Understanding of Agile practices and continuous integration. Familiarity with CI/CD pipelines, Docker and Kubernetes Nice to have: * Knowledge of Oracle JET / VBCS * Familiarity with Microservices * Knowledge of Python, AI, GEN AI and ML As a member of the software engineering division, you will assist in defining and developing software for tasks associated with the developing, debugging or designing of software applications or operating systems. Provide technical leadership to other software developers. Specify, design and implement modest changes to existing software architecture to meet changing needs.
Oracle
Upload Resume
Drag or click to upload
Your data is secure with us, protected by advanced encryption.
My Connections Oracle
Bengaluru, Karnataka, India
Salary: Not disclosed
Bengaluru, Karnataka, India
Salary: Not disclosed
, , India
Salary: Not disclosed
Hyderabad
25.0 - 30.0 Lacs P.A.
Bengaluru
25.0 - 30.0 Lacs P.A.
Bengaluru
25.0 - 30.0 Lacs P.A.
Bengaluru
25.0 - 30.0 Lacs P.A.
Chennai, Tamil Nadu, India
Salary: Not disclosed
Bengaluru, Karnataka, India
Salary: Not disclosed
Hyderabad, Telangana, India
Salary: Not disclosed